The New Orleans Hornets host Washington on Thursday, looking to build on their 10-33 mark against the 9-32 Wizards in NBA action at New Orleans Arena.

The Hornets sit at 10-33 (20-23 ATS) on the season; in comparison, the Wizards are currently 9-32 (14-27 ATS). Looking to wager on the totals? New Orleans is 20-22-1 OU, and Washington is 22-19 OU.

In their last action, Washington was a 107-98 loser on the road against the Mavericks. They covered the 12.5-point spread as underdogs, while the combined score (205) was profitable news for OVER bettors. The Wizards got a 20-point performance from Trevor Booker, who added 12 rebounds, but Dallas still ran past Washington 107-98 on Tuesday at American Airlines Center.

New Orleans was a 107-101 loser in its last match at home against the Lakers. They failed to cover the 4.5-point spread as underdogs, while the total score of 208 sent OVER bettors to the payout window. The Hornets got a terrific 30-point performance from Jarrett Jack but Los Angeles handed them a 107-101 defeat on Wednesday at New Orleans Arena.
